Reita and CII unite for IFA property boost

clock

Reita, the education and awareness campaign for property investment and REITs and The Chartered Insurance Institute (CII), are working together to extend the diploma level investment paper to include property investment as an asset class.

The relevant property investment syllabus and exam structure is slated for introduction early next year, the CII adds. The move comes following research by Reita last year which showed almost 60% of advisers were interested in qualifications in property investment.
